Whereas in Louisiana Claire could receive 4 hours of OT/month through the Early Intervention Program, here she gets FIVE...yes.... 5 hours PER WEEK.....AT OUR HOUSE!!!!! The entire team of OT, PT, Speech, and Developmental Specialist work together toward common goals. In addition, her developmental specialist is our case manager, and she processes all of our insurance paperwork/referrals!
